Cloud mining in cryptocurrencies: a complete guide to risks and opportunities

In summary - Cloud mining is the process of participating in crypto mining without physically owning the hardware. - While it offers convenience for those who want to mine without technical skills, it is important to know that the industry is rife with scams. - Before investing, thorough research is essential.

Blockchain: Redefining the Infrastructure of Digital Transactions

Summary of Key Points
- Blockchain is a distributed digital ledger that securely records transaction data across a global network of computers, representing a revolutionary significance compared to traditional banking systems.
- Through cryptography and consensus mechanisms, blockchain ensures the immutability of data; once information is recorded, it cannot be modified or traced back.
- Blockchain not only supports the ecosystem of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um but is also widely applied in various fields such as supply chain management, healthcare, and voting systems, bringing transparency, security, and trust to various industries.
The starting point of the technological revolution
Blockchain technology has profoundly changed multiple industries, particularly the financial sector. Compared to the centralized management model of traditional banks, blockchain introduces a completely new paradigm: a decentralized, transparent, and secure data and transaction management mechanism. Shorting: How to trade in falling markets

Core points
- Shorting means selling an asset with the expectation of buying it back at a lower price.
- This strategy requires borrowed funds, initial collateral, maintenance margin, and interest payments.
- Traders use shorting for both speculation and risk management

How Crypto Airdrops Distribute Digital Assets to the Community

Airdrops are a strategic method for blockchain projects to expand user bases and enhance token distribution. Unlike ICOs, airdrops provide free tokens to eligible wallet holders, ensuring accessibility and promoting liquidity. This approach parallels rewards from hard forks, benefiting long-term holders without requiring further investment.
